A “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les” video game is in development. The game is already listed in the Australian Classification Board, with Japanese developer Platinum Games, known for the “Bayonetta” series and “Metal Gear: Revengeance,” listed as the creator behind the game.

Dubbed “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les: Mutants in Manhattan,” the game will be under Activision as well, as per the official board’s website. The new game is rated M (Moderate) due to some violent actions. In Australia, the classification “M” is not legally restricted but is applied to films and games recommended for person aged 15 and above.

Not much is known about the game for now, though Gematsu has confirmed that it would be released on Xbox 360, Xbox One, PS3, PS4 and PC. Neither Platinum Games nor Activision have spoken out on the record yet. However, the two companies have had a history of work together.

Some of the titles that have come out from Activision and Platinum games include “Transformer Devastation” and “The Legend of Korra.” If Platinum Games develops “TMNT” inspired by the 90’s cartoon series or early comics, the game can be a big hit.

Platinum Games is currently busy with its action role-playing game “Nier: Automata,” which is coming to PS4 in 2016. Also slated to come next year are “Star Fox Zero” for the Wii U and “Scalebound” for the Xbox One.
